October 19, 2025
Digital Nomads: The global tech recruiter who can chose where to build a career

From her base in the UK, Rhoda Adeola manages recruitment for companies across Europe, the US, and Asia-Pacific, matching talent to opportunity across time zones. As a global tech recruiter, she has learned that a meaningful career doesn’t always require mobility…
Read More

About The Author

Leave a Reply

Your email address will not be published. Required fields are marked *